Donna Kay Bailey Obituary

With heavy hearts, we announce the death of Donna Kay Bailey (Newnan, Georgia), born in Charleston, West Virginia, who passed away on May 8, 2023 at the age of 72. Leave a sympathy message to the family on the memorial page of Donna Kay Bailey to pay them a last tribute.

She was predeceased by: her parents, Peter and Viola; and her siblings, Bob, Mary, Nancy, Peggy and Joe.

She is survived by: her significant other Steve Bailey; her children, Nancy Rickabaugh (Marc) and Matthew Bailey (Courtney); her sisters, Pat and Carol; and her grandchildren, Layne, Sydney (Alex), Molly (Aric), Andrew and Olivia.

Interment will follow at Georgia National Cemetery in Canton at 1 p.m. Flowers or contributions to Southwest Christian Care (hospice) of Union City, Georgia are both welcome.
